Meaning of Fingerprint

The unique pattern of ridges on the tip of a finger.

In simple words: The mark made by the pattern of lines on a finger.

Fingerprint in a sentence

  • The detective found a fingerprint on the window.
  • She left her fingerprint on the glass after touching it.
  • Fingerprints are used for identification purposes in many countries.
  • He was arrested after his fingerprint matched the crime scene evidence.
  • The security system requires a fingerprint to unlock the door.
